**Runbook: Swiftcrate parcel-tracking webhook**

Reviewer notes: the webhook handler must ack within 3 seconds or Swiftcrate's dispatcher retries with exponential backoff, causing duplicate scan events. Dedup key is parcel id + scan timestamp — verify any change preserves that. Payloads over 64KB get truncated upstream; reject, don't parse. Check idempotency tests pass before approving. Confirm the handler logs the delivery's trace token on every request; the expected format is shown below.

build token for fajof-yahof: htk4_869f

CI note for release management: the Tallyhook pipeline failed overnight because the calendar sync job hit a conflict between the Meridian staging calendar and the Quillforge booking feed. Both wrote to the same slot table, and the merge step aborted rather than overwrite. We disabled the Quillforge feed on the runner and reran; green since 06:40. If it recurs, pause the nightly sync stage first. The failing run is identified by the token below.

trace token, fafog-kageg: htk4_98e6

Ticket: Security sign-off required — BounceSift email bounce processor. BounceSift parses inbound bounce notifications for the Larkmail platform and updates suppression lists. Changes in this release: raw bounce payloads are now retained for 14 days instead of 30, and PII fields are masked before storage. No new external endpoints were added. Reviewer should verify the masking logic and retention job. Sign-off is required from the accountable engineer, listed below.

account owner for kagef-kahag: Norwyn Quenmir Ulaax

## Deploying the Gatewick Proctor Queue

Deploys are pretty painless: push to main, wait for the pipeline, then watch the queue drain dashboard for five minutes. If candidates pile up mid-exam, roll back first and ask questions later — the queue replays safely. Everything the workers care about lives in one config block, shown here for reference.

settings of bafof-yagef:
JOROX_PIN=8740
JOROX_TENANT=pelox
JOROX_METRICS_HOST=metrics.jorox.qorvelworks.internal
JOROX_SEAL=seal_c78f63c1
JOROX_STANDBY_TEAM=norax